Trisura Group (TSE:TSU – Get Free Report) had its target price upped by stock analysts at ATB Cormark Capital Markets from C$46.75 to C$52.00 in a research note issued on Friday,BayStreet.CA reports. The firm presently has an “outperform” rating on the stock. ATB Cormark Capital Markets’ price objective would suggest a potential upside of 4.80% from the stock’s current price.
Other analysts have also issued research reports about the stock. Royal Bank Of Canada lifted their price objective on shares of Trisura Group from C$55.00 to C$57.00 in a research note on Monday, November 10th. National Bank Financial lifted their price target on shares of Trisura Group from C$57.00 to C$59.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a research note on Wednesday, February 4th. Finally, Desjardins set a C$56.00 price objective on shares of Trisura Group and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a report on Thursday, December 18th. Five research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, According to MarketBeat.com, the company currently has a consensus rating of “Buy” and a consensus target price of C$54.88.

Trisura Group (TSE:TSU –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, November 6th. The company reported C$0.71 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ter. Trisura Group had a net margin of 3.76% and a return on equity of 16.30%. The company had revenue of C$799.34 million during the quarter. As a group, equities analysts expect that Trisura Group will post 3.1349036 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Trisura Group Company Profile
Trisura Group Ltd is a Canadian based company engages in the provision of specialty insurance. The company’s operations currently include specialty property and casualty insurance (Surety, Risk Solutions, and Corporate Insurance business lines), underwritten predominantly in Canada. The operating business segments are Trisura Guarantee, Trisura Specialty, and Trisura International. The Trisura Guarantee segment generates maximum revenue, which offers Surety, Risk Solutions and Corporate Insurance products underwritten in Canada as well as the operations of Trisura Warranty.
